Apple russet on Yellow Newtown Pippin
Using compounds that were successful in treating russet-sensitive Golden Delicious apples, scientists tested Yellow Newtown Pippins in the Pajaro Valley for response against russeting. The treatments did not reduce russet enough to warrant use.

University of Florida Potato Variety Trial Spotlight: Goldrush
‘Goldrush’ is a russet potato variety commonly grown for the fresh potato market particularly for baking and boiling. It was selected from the progeny of a cross between ND450-3Russ and Lemhi Russet at North Dakota State University (Johansen et al. 1993)

The Impact of Coordination of Production and Marketing Strategies on Price Behavior: Evidence from the Idaho Potato Industry [PDF]
High potato price volatility, decreasing demand for fresh potatoes and prices below the cost of production led to a decision of a number of Idaho potato growers to organize the United Fresh Potato Growers of Idaho, a marketing cooperative.
